WebOct 4, 2024 · The 20 year rule on long residence is contained in Appendix Private Life of the Immigration Rules. Under the 20 year rule, a person does not have to have lived in the UK lawfully, but simply “continuously”. The definition of “continuous residence” is almost the same as for the 10 year lawful residence route, with two notable differences.

WebOct 17, 2024 · Further Applications – Regularising Leave to Remain. If your leave has been curtailed and you have 60 days in which to regularise your stay you will need to consider what application you may be able to make from within the UK.
